A leading waste management company in Slough seeks a dynamic Driver to join their Operations team. The role offers a competitive salary, driver bonus scheme, and a supportive work environment.
Responsibilities include:
- Operating waste collection vehicles
- Ensuring exceptional service to customers
Successful candidates will hold a valid LGV Class 2 licence and demonstrate strong communication and teamwork skills. This full-time position promises opportunities for career growth and a commitment to leaving a better planet.
